In a practical investigation, what energy transfer occurs when a ball is dropped from a height?

  1. A. Kinetic energy to thermal energy
  2. B. Gravitational potential energy to kinetic energy
  3. C. Kinetic energy to elastic potential energy
  4. D. Thermal energy to gravitational potential energy

Answer

Gravitational potential energy to kinetic energy

Explanation

When the ball is dropped, its gravitational potential energy is converted into kinetic energy as it falls.

Common mistake

Confusing gravitational potential energy with kinetic energy

Students often think that when an object falls, the energy it has is still gravitational potential energy rather than kinetic energy

Explain that as the object falls, gravitational potential energy is converted into kinetic energy; at the moment of impact the energy is predominantly kinetic, with potential energy reduced to zero
